Description

This will be a Phase 1, open-label study to evaluate the safety and efficacy of BEAM-201 in patients with R/R T-ALL or T-LLy. BEAM-201 is an allogeneic anti-CD7 CART therapy.

Official Title

A Phase 1 Study of Allogeneic Anti-CD7 CAR-T Cells (BEAM-201) in Relapsed/Refractory T-cell Acute Lymphoblastic Leukemia (T-ALL) or T-cell Lymphoblastic Lymphoma (T-LLy)

Inclusion CriteriaExclusion Criteria
  1. 1. Ages 0 to 29 years.
  2. 2. T-ALL/T-LLy in second or greater relapse, first relapse post-transplant, or chemotherapy-refractory disease. Specifically:
  3. * Second or greater relapse or post-transplant relapse, defined as:
  4. * BM with ≥ 5% lymphoblasts by morphologic assessment or evidence of extramedullary disease after second documented CR; OR
  5. * Flow cytometric confirmation of relapsed T-ALL of at least 0.1% after second CR documented to have been MRD negative \< 0.1%; OR
  6. * Any detectable relapsed disease post-allogeneic HSCT with flow cytometric confirmation of T-ALL of at least 0.1%; OR
  7. * Biopsy confirmed evidence of relapsed T-LLy after second CR; OR
  8. * Any detectable disease post-allogeneic transplant with biopsy confirmed evidence of T-LLy
  9. * Refractory disease, defined as:
  10. * Primary refractory T-ALL or T-LLy, defined as failure to achieve CR after induction chemotherapy, per investigator assessment and based on biopsy- or MRD-confirmed evidence of residual T-ALL or T-LLy; OR
  11. * Relapsed, refractory disease, defined as \> 0.1 % MRD or morphologic evidence of disease or evidence of residual T-LLy after 1 course of re-induction chemotherapy for patients who have relapsed after previously achieving a CR
  12. 3. Documentation of CD7 expression on leukemic blasts (defined as at least 20% of blasts positive for CD7 by flow cytometry or immunohistochemistry).
  13. 4. Patients with prior or current history of CNS3 disease will be eligible if CNS disease is responsive to therapy
  14. 5. Eligible for myeloablative conditioning for and allogeneic HSCT based on the investigator's assessment with an available donor identified by a FACT accredited transplant center.
  15. 6. Lansky Performance Status (ages \< 16 years at time of consent) or Karnofsky Performance Status (KPS) (ages ≥ 16 years at time of consent) score of ≥ 50.
  16. 7. Patients of childbearing potential must have a negative urine or serum pregnancy test at screening.
  17. 8. Patients who are sexually active and of reproductive potential must agree to use an acceptable form of highly effective contraception from consent to 12 months after BEAM 201 infusion.
  18. 9. Patients (ages ≥ 18 years) or parent/legal guardians (for patients ages \< 18 years) must provide signed, written informed consent according to local IRB and institutional requirements.
